Girl Scouts San Diego Director of Human Resources in San Diego, California

Girl Scouts San Diego is seeking a strategic yet hands-on Director of Human Resources. You’ll lead and shape long-term people and culture initiatives including recruitment, employee relations, performance management and day-to-day HR operations, and serve as a trusted advisor and member of the senior leadership team.

What You'll Do

As Director of Human Resources, you will:

  • Partner with senior leadership to develop and implement people strategies that support a high-performing, values-driven culture.

  • Lead and manage day-to-day HR operations across recruitment, employee relations, performance management, and compliance.

  • Design and implement HR programs, policies and procedures aligned with organizational goals.

  • Drive talent strategies including workforce planning, recruitment, and retention.

  • Coach and advise managers at all levels to strengthen leadership capability and ensure equitable people practices.

  • Lead learning and development initiatives to build staff and leadership capacity.

  • Develop and implement employee engagement and retention strategies.

  • Oversee employee relations, providing expert guidance and ensuring fair, timely, and consistent resolution of workplace issues.

  • Lead performance management processes that promote accountability, feedback, and professional growth.

  • Oversee compensation, benefits, and HR systems to ensure competitiveness, equity, and operational efficiency.

  • Ensure compliance with applicable employment laws, regulations, and reporting requirements.

  • Manage the HR budget and resources with a focus on impact and efficiency.

  • Lead and empower the HR team through effective management and professional development.
